-package bjc.inflexion;
-
-/**
- * Implementation of {@link NounInflection} for nouns matched by a regular
- * expression.
- *
- * @author EVE
- *
- */
-public class CategoricalNounInflection implements NounInflection {
- private static final String TOSTRING_FMT = "CategoricalNounInflection [singular=%s, modernPlural=%s,"
- + " classicalPlural=%s]";
-
- private InflectionAffix singular;
-
- private InflectionAffix modernPlural;
- private InflectionAffix classicalPlural;
-
- /**
- * Create a new categorical inflection.
- *
- * @param singlar
- * The affix for the singular form.
- *
- * @param modrnPlural
- * The affix for the modern plural.
- *
- * @param classiclPlural
- * The affix for the classical plural.
- */
- public CategoricalNounInflection(InflectionAffix singlar, InflectionAffix modrnPlural,
- InflectionAffix classiclPlural) {
- if(singlar == null)
- throw new NullPointerException("Singular form must not be null");
- else if(modrnPlural == null && classiclPlural == null)
- throw new NullPointerException("One of modern/classical plural forms must not be null");
-
- singular = singlar;
- modernPlural = modrnPlural;
- classicalPlural = classiclPlural;
- }
-
- @Override
- public boolean matches(String noun) {
- if(singular.hasAffix(noun))
- return true;
- else if(modernPlural != null && modernPlural.hasAffix(noun))
- return true;
- else if(classicalPlural != null && classicalPlural.hasAffix(noun))
- return true;
- else
- return false;
- }
-
- @Override
- public boolean isSingular(String noun) {
- if(singular.hasAffix(noun))
- return true;
- else if(matchesPlural(noun))
- return false;
- else {
- String msg = String.format("Noun '%s' doesn't belong to this inflection", noun, this);
-
- throw new InflectionException(msg);
- }
- }
-
- @Override
- public boolean isPlural(String noun) {
- if(singular.hasAffix(noun))
- return false;
- else if(matchesPlural(noun))
- return true;
- else {
- String msg = String.format("Noun '%s' doesn't belong to this inflection", noun, this);
-
- throw new InflectionException(msg);
- }
- }
-
- @Override
- public String singularize(String plural) {
- if(singular.hasAffix(plural))
- return plural;
- else if(modernPlural != null && modernPlural.hasAffix(plural))
- return singular.affix(modernPlural.deaffix(plural));
- else if(classicalPlural != null && classicalPlural.hasAffix(plural))
- return singular.affix(classicalPlural.deaffix(plural));
- else {
- String msg = String.format("Noun '%s' doesn't belong to this inflection", plural, this);
-
- throw new InflectionException(msg);
- }
- }
-
- @Override
- public String pluralize(String singlar) {
- if(singular.hasAffix(singlar)) {
- if(modernPlural == null) {
- return classicalPlural.affix(singular.deaffix(singlar));
- } else {
- return modernPlural.affix(singular.deaffix(singlar));
- }
- } else if(matchesPlural(singlar)) {
- return singlar;
- } else {
- String msg = String.format("Noun '%s' doesn't belong to this inflection", singlar, this);
-
- throw new InflectionException(msg);
- }
- }
-
- private boolean matchesPlural(String noun) {
- boolean hasModernPlural = modernPlural != null && modernPlural.hasAffix(noun);
-
- return hasModernPlural || (classicalPlural != null && classicalPlural.hasAffix(noun));
- }
-
- @Override
- public String toString() {
- return String.format(TOSTRING_FMT, singular, modernPlural, classicalPlural);
- }
-
- @Override
- public int hashCode() {
- final int prime = 31;
- int result = 1;
-
- result = prime * result + ((classicalPlural == null) ? 0 : classicalPlural.hashCode());
- result = prime * result + ((modernPlural == null) ? 0 : modernPlural.hashCode());
-
- return result;
- }
-
- @Override
- public boolean equals(Object obj) {
- if(this == obj) return true;
- if(obj == null) return false;
- if(!(obj instanceof CategoricalNounInflection)) return false;
-
- CategoricalNounInflection other = (CategoricalNounInflection) obj;
-
- if(classicalPlural == null) {
- if(other.classicalPlural != null) return false;
- } else if(!classicalPlural.equals(other.classicalPlural)) return false;
-
- if(modernPlural == null) {
- if(other.modernPlural != null) return false;
- } else if(!modernPlural.equals(other.modernPlural)) return false;
-
- return true;
- }
-
- @Override
- public String pluralizeModern(String singlar) {
- if(modernPlural == null) return pluralizeClassical(singlar);
-
- String actSinglar = singlar;
- if(isPlural(singlar)) {
- actSinglar = singularize(singlar);
- }
-
- return modernPlural.affix(singular.deaffix(actSinglar));
- }
-
- @Override
- public String pluralizeClassical(String singlar) {
- if(classicalPlural == null) return pluralizeModern(singlar);
-
- String actSinglar = singlar;
- if(isPlural(singlar)) {
- actSinglar = singularize(singlar);
- }
-
- return classicalPlural.affix(singular.deaffix(actSinglar));
- }
-} \ No newline at end of file
